British actor Tom Blyth is making his Netflix debut in the romantic comedy People We Meet on Vacation, out January 9.
The 30-year-old plays Alex, a reserved high school teacher, who spends his summers traveling with his easygoing friend Poppy (Emily Bader), until a falling-out forces them to confront their feelings for each other on one final vacation.
Blyth revealed that he jumped at the opportunity to star in a romcom. “I was just eager to do something light and fun, and a bit sexy,” he said in an interview with People in January. “I’ve been doing a lot of serious films back-to-back. So I was ready for something a bit more light.”
Blyth recently appeared in a number of dramas and thrillers, including the 2025 films The Fence, Wasteman, and Plainclothes, but is perhaps best known for his role as Coriolanus Snow in 2023’s The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songbird & Snakes.

Blyth made his own movies as a kid
Growing up in the suburbs of Nottingham, England, Blyth discovered his passion for acting at an early age. The child of divorced parents, he often frequented the movies with his father, TV producer Gavin Blyth, during their monthly visits and soon began making his own short films.
“I would go outside with my stepbrother and my friends, and we’d make our own zombie films or little clips and then edit them together on whatever the equivalent of iMovie was back then, on the Windows computer,” the actor told Sharp magazine in October 2025. “That was the first seedling of trying to do it—not professionally—but actually making something. That was probably when I was like nine or ten.”
His father’s death pushed him into acting
When he was just 14 years old, Blyth’s father died of non-Hodgkin lymphoma. The tragic loss ultimately propelled him to pursue a career in film—a dream he and his dad shared. Shortly after his father’s passing, one of Blyth’s teachers at Nottingham’s Television Workshop advised him to use his grief as an acting tool.
“His bluntness was mortifying, but thankfully I saw that my grief wasn’t something to hide away but to channel as an actor,” he told The Wall Street Journal in June 2022. The following year, he landed his first professional acting role in the 2010 film Robin Hood, starring Russell Crowe.
He went to Juilliard
After moving to London to join the National Youth Theatre, Blyth went on to perfect his craft at Juilliard in New York City. In an interview with The Times in November 2023, he confessed that relocating to the United States helped him gain more confidence in his acting abilities. “I knew I had good instincts for acting and I knew that I liked performing but I couldn’t let go of my own self-judgment,” Blyth said. “It was a slow process of coming out of my shell, which culminated in me going to the States to try and knock down the wall.”
After graduating in 2020, the actor appeared in the 2021 war drama Benediction. Just two years later, he landed his breakout role as the titular character in the MGM+ series Billy the Kid, which ran for three seasons. The following year, Blyth starred in The Hunger Games prequel, The Ballad of Songbirds & Snakes, marking his first major blockbuster.
He knows how to horseback ride
During his time on Billy the Kid, he became at an expert at horseback riding. He quickly learned to ride just three weeks before filming started, and, once on set, did most of his own stunt work. “They let me ride, they let me fall off horses, they let me wrangle cattle—crazy stuff—run on rooftops while shooting guns,” Blyth recalled to People in October 2025. “It’s like old-school filmmaking.”
Blyth uses music to get into character
Besides studying the script, the actor gets into character, in part, by listening to music, especially if the project is set in the past. “I’ll listen to the music of that time or try to immerse myself in the culture of that time, because I think that all makes up who we are,” he told Sharp. “On Plainclothes, we had a big, long playlist of ‘90s music.”
He’s an avid surfer
When he’s not busy on set, Blyth enjoys being outdoors, and can often be found hanging out in either the mountains or the ocean. “I spend a lot of time in upstate New York and still go there to get away in between jobs,” he told Numéro Netherlands in December 2023. “I also took up surfing 6 years ago and that gives me a lot of joy.” Describing himself as an ambivert, Blyth revealed he also likes reading, watching movies, and going out with his friends.
How to Watch People We Meet on Vacation on Netflix
People We Meet on Vacation arrives on Netflix January 9. The movie adaptation of Emily Henry’s 2021 novel stars Tom Blyth as Alex and Emily Bader as Poppy.
